TL;DR Summary

The race for control of the U.S. House of Representatives remains undecided, with Republicans optimistic about securing a governing trifecta alongside their Senate majority and President-elect Donald Trump. Republicans need 12 more seats to maintain their majority, while Democrats require 33 to flip control. Key races in California, Maine, and Alaska remain uncalled. Democrats have heavily outspent Republicans in competitive races, aiming to regain the House. The outcome will influence the legislative power of the next Trump administration, with significant issues like government funding and tax cuts on the agenda.
